#0b794f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b794f is composed of 4.3% red, 47.5%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.7%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 157.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 25.9%. #0b794f color hex could be obtained by blending #16f29e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#0b794f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d09 is the darkest color, while #fafff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0b794f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4643 is the less saturated color, while #018351 is the most saturated one.
